When I add a Macro via the Add Unit menu, I would like them organized into submenus, similar to how "Start", "Update", etc are in the Lifetime submenu. Could there be a metadata tag on the Macro that would specify the specified submenu (e.g. "Maths" or "AI/Behaviours"). If the tag is empty, then it would be a child of the Macro menu; otherwise, it would be a child of the designated submenu (or submenus if there are '/'s present).

Good point, I'll look into this.

One other related thing I'd like to look into is giving super units custom icons.


(Sorry for the bump/necro, I'm doing some roadmap grooming following the Unity acquisition!)

This is now supported in Bolt 2 via classes; all classes can be categorized at any level of nesting and show up accordingly in the fuzzy finder and explorer window. Their members show as children of the classes under proper separator groups.